9/12/13 |
NW |
NW13-025 Support of UFCW Locals 21 & 367, Teamsters Local 38 in
Negotiations With Assorted Grocery Chains and Independent Stores.
|
It is moved that: The NW SPEEA Council supports UFCW local 21 and
associated unions in their struggle in negotiations with the union grocery
stores. The NW Council requests the Executive Board provide Staff with
direction to take steps in informing our members about this issue via our
publications and information networks and urge our members to shop at union
grocery stores and support the union workers during negotiations and if they
go out on strike. It is further moved that: The Northwest Council supports
giving up to $5000.00 out of the annually budgeted labor support fund, should
a strike happen and support is needed by UFCW locals 21, 367 or Teamsters
Local 38. |
9/12/13 |
NW |
NW13-024 Support of SPFPA Local 5 facing outsourcing of Boeing guards to
non-union contracted Guards.
|
It is moved that: The NW SPEEA Council supports SPFPA Local 5. The NW
Council requests the Executive Board provide staff with direction to take
steps in informing our members about
the outsourcing of Boeing union guards via our publications and information
networks and urge our members to thank the union guards that are members of
SPFPA Local 5. It is further moved that: The Northwest Council supports SPFPA
in future contract negotiations that they will have with Boeing in 2017. |

6/7/13 |
SPEEA |
MW13-017 Motion to Support the Student Right to Know Before You Go Act. |
It is moved that: The SPEEA Council support the Student Right to Know Before You Go Act and related measures to improve available education and workforce data for the benefit of students, families and workers. Furthermore, the SPEEA Council supports the SPEEA L&PA Committee and SPEEA staff in efforts to advocate on behalf of such measures. |
6/7/13 |
SPEEA |
MW13-016 Motion to Protect the National Labor Relations Act and the Fair Labor Standards Act. |
It is moved that: The SPEEA Council support the L&PA Committee and SPEEA Legislative staff in efforts to counter legislation, amendments or agency rulemaking that would undermine or erode worker protections under the National Labor Relations Act or the Fair Labor Standards Act and to support measures that protect or strengthen established workplace rights via these two Acts.
And, be it further moved, that the SPEEA Council will also encourage members to support legislative efforts to protect established workplace rights via these two Acts. |
